I spent a lot of time in Asia. Not as a tourist—as a student of how things get made. I saw factories that could copy anything in 48 hours. That's not innovation. That's a Xerox machine with an army. But something changed. The question everyone asks now: "Is China a leader in technology innovation?" My answer: parts of it, yes. And that's terrifying for everyone else. Here's the definition you need to remember: China's self-innovation is the country's ability to develop proprietary technologies and products that compete globally on their own merits. Here is why that matters: it shifts the center of gravity in tech from Silicon Valley to Shenzhen, and it forces every Western company to stop coasting on brand loyalty. Look at the evidence. According to the World Intellectual Property Organization's 2024 report, China filed over 1.6 million patent applications—more than any other country. That number alone doesn't mean shit. But look at what they're doing with those patents. Huawei built a 5G stack that's genuinely world-class. DJI owns 70% of the global drone market because their hardware and software are vertically integrated—something I respect deeply. ByteDance's TikTok algorithm is insanely good at understanding human behavior. That's not copycat work. That's real "technology married with liberal arts" thinking. The benefits of China's self-innovation are obvious: cheaper advanced manufacturing, faster iteration cycles, and a massive domestic market that rewards usable products over flashy specs. They're building smart glasses without cameras (Realities is a good example) because they understand that productivity beats surveillance gimmicks. That's the kind of focus I admire. But let's be honest. There's a dark side. Most Chinese tech companies still suffer from "feature bloat"—they throw everything at the wall because they're scared of missing a trend. That's the opposite of insanely great. And government control? It creates a ceiling. True disruption comes from people who can say no to authority. Read more about this in our piece on how Huawei defied U.S. sanctions. The question is whether the next iPhone-level breakthrough can come from a system that punishes rebellion. My thesis: China's self-innovation is real, and it's going to scare the hell out of Apple, Google, and everyone else. But they're still learning the hardest lesson: saying no to a thousand good ideas to focus on the one that changes everything. Until they master that, they're promising. Not finished. China leads in 5G infrastructure, drone hardware, mobile payment systems, and AI-powered consumer apps. But it still lags in original processor design, foundational operating systems, and the kind of design philosophy that creates products people love rather than just use. Q2: What are the benefits of China's self-innovation? Lower costs for advanced electronics, faster product cycles, and a massive domestic ecosystem that forces companies to iterate rapidly. It also pressures Western firms to innovate rather than rely on brand inertia. The global consumer wins when competition is real. Q3: Can China produce a product as revolutionary as the iPhone? Not yet. Revolutionary products require an integrated vision that combines hardware, software, and services with a single-minded focus on user experience—something I called "the whole widget." China has the components, but the pieces don't always talk to each other. The day they do, we're all in trouble.
